Wie berechnet man Polygonflächen und -umfänge mit QGIS?

13

Wenn ich mit QGIS eine Polygonebene lade und eine neue Spalte erstelle, wie fülle ich diese Spalte mit:

  1. Fläche jedes Polygons und eine weitere Spalte mit
  2. Länge des Umfangs jedes Polygons?
HealthMaps
quelle
1
Also habe ich das Shapefile in der Projektions-UTM geändert und gespeichert, um die Quadratmeterfläche zu erhalten, aber ich erhalte immer noch einen niedrigen Dezimalwert für die Fläche. Beispielsweise wird ein Polygon mit einer Fläche von 102 km2 in der Attributtabelle bei 0,0102 angezeigt. Ich habe beide Methoden fTools und den Rechner in der Attributtabelle verwendet. Was mache ich falsch? Vielen Dank
Ich sah auch absurd niedrige Zahlen, aber ich denke, das lag daran, dass ich das falsche CRS hatte. Ich klickte auf das Symbol unten rechts und änderte das CRS und die Zahlen sahen danach besser aus.
Brian Z
ähnliche Frage: gis.stackexchange.com/q/23355/4630
Tomas
In Qgis 2.19 gibt es im Vektormenü keine Geometriewerkzeuge. Muss ich sie herunterladen? Vielen Dank für Ihre Antwort
Thibault
Wenn Sie eine ähnliche Frage haben, erstellen Sie eine neue Frage. Hier finden Sie Antworten auf die ursprüngliche Frage.
Mattropolis

Antworten:

26

Öffnen Sie den Feldrechner, wählen Sie die neue Spalte aus und geben Sie den folgenden Ausdruck ein

  • Für Fläche: $ Fläche
  • Für Umfang: $ Umfang

Stellen Sie sicher, dass sich Ihre Ebene in einem projizierten Koordinatensystem (nicht lat / long) und in korrekten Einheiten befindet. (Wenn die Projektion Ihres Layers "Meter" als Einheiten enthält, ist Ihre Fläche Quadratmeter.) Beachten Sie, dass durch die direkte Neuprojektion von Layern die Einheiten für die Berechnung von Fläche / Umfang nicht geändert werden. Sie müssen daher zunächst mit Speichern unter neu projizieren. .. mit dem richtigen Ziel CRS.

Bildbeschreibung hier eingeben

Bildbeschreibung hier eingeben

räumliche Gedanken
quelle
Gibt es andere Funktionen, die mit $ beginnen?
HealthMaps
2
Viele davon sehen Sie im Feldrechner. In QGIS 1.8 ist es gut organisiert unter 'Funktionsliste' im
Feldrechner
7

Sie können auch fTools verwenden: Vektormenü -> Geometriewerkzeuge -> Geometriespalten exportieren / hinzufügen

Der Layer wird automatisch aktualisiert, indem AREA- und PERIMETER-Spalten hinzugefügt werden.

lrssvt
quelle